Why IT projects always take longer than planned (and how to catch it in time)

Almost no IT project finishes when it was planned to. It's not bad luck or a lack of talent: it's the way we underestimate time and, above all, how we manage it. Time isn't underestimated out of optimism. It's underestimated by design.

The easy explanation is that we're too optimistic when we plan. That's true, but it's only the surface. The deeper problem is that we estimate the time for visible work and ignore the time for invisible work: the validations that depend on third parties, the integrations that “should just work,” the accesses that take weeks, the decisions left waiting on someone who was on vacation.

That invisible work is almost never measured, and yet it's what weighs the most. A good estimate isn't the one that assumes everything will go well: it's the one that reserves an explicit margin for dependencies and the unexpected. As a rule of thumb, a project that doesn't set aside at least 15% or 20% of its time for what doesn't depend on the technical team isn't estimated: it's gambled.

That's why a project doesn't fall behind the day a server goes down. It falls behind much earlier, in all those hours no one counted because they weren't in the plan.


The four causes we see repeat

  1. Scope that grows in silence. Every “while we're at it, let's add this” seems minor. Added up, they redefine the project without anyone having moved the delivery date.
  2. Dependencies that aren't managed. The technical team can be excellent, but if it depends on a third party that responds whenever it can, the schedule is set by the slowest link, not the fastest.
  3. Estimates with no margin for the unexpected. You plan for the scenario where everything goes well. And in real operations, something always turns out different from what was expected.
  4. No clear owner of time. When everyone owns the project, no one owns the deadline. And what has no owner stretches.

Five signs your project is already behind, even if it shows “on schedule”

Delay rarely announces itself. It builds up quietly and only becomes visible when there's no margin left. These are the early signs worth watching before the schedule confirms it:

  1. There are tasks blocked waiting on third parties —and that block is taken as “normal” instead of being treated as an active risk.
  2. The team starts working on assumptions because definitions are still missing. It moves forward, yes, but on a base that may have to be redone.
  3. Small tasks get added that don't formally change the scope. No one signs a change, but the project being executed is no longer the one that was planned.
  4. Progress is measured by finished tasks, not by milestones met. You can be “80% done” on tasks and 40% on the milestones that really matter.
  5. The final date stays intact even though the buffers are already used up. If the contingency margin was spent in the first half and the date didn't move, the delay already exists: it just hasn't been declared yet.

None of these signs is technical. They're all about management. And that's the most important distinction: a one-off delay is solved with effort; a structural problem repeats project after project, always for the same reasons. If the delay keeps showing up with different teams and different technologies, the problem isn't estimation. It's the model used to manage it.


How time is managed when it's part of the service

The difference between a project that stretches out of control and one that slips little and warns in time isn't in the technology. It's in the management model. And that model rests on concrete decisions:

  1. A single owner of the deadline, distinct from the technical lead. Someone whose job is to protect the date, not execute the tasks.
  2. Dependencies managed formally: identified at the start, with an owner and a committed date from each third party, and follow-up before they block, not after.
  3. Scope controlled with judgment: every new request is accepted, but its impact on time is made visible. It's not about slowing the business down, but about making the decision to add something a conscious one.
  4. Weekly indicators that look at milestones and buffers, not just closed tasks: how much margin is left, which dependencies are at risk, what deviations appeared. Deviations are caught while they can still be corrected.

When time is treated as a variable that is measured and governed —and not as a promise made at the start and forgotten— the project stops surprising you. Not because there are no surprises, but because there's a model that anticipates, contains, and communicates them.


The question worth asking your IT provider

Here's the point that matters most. A good IT provider doesn't just execute tasks and report progress. It manages dependencies, risks, timing, and communication so the client gets something worth more than speed: predictability.

That's why, rather than asking “will you finish on time?” —a promise that's easy to make and hard to keep— it's better to ask how the project is managed: Is there an owner of the deadline, in addition to the technical lead? How are dependencies with third parties identified and tracked? What happens, specifically, when the delay depends on someone who is neither you nor the provider? What indicators will you see each week, and do they show milestones and margins or only closed tasks?

The answers to those questions separate the provider that “does the task” from the partner that takes ownership of the outcome. The next time an IT project runs late, before asking what failed technically, it's worth asking something different: was someone actually managing the time, or were we simply waiting for it?

Because most of the delays that cost a lot weren't technical. They were predictable. It's just that no one was watching them.
